L3 Harris is one of the largest defense and aerospace companies in the United States, delivering advanced technologies that support missions across air, land, sea, space, and cyber domains. The company develops communications systems, space payloads, intelligence platforms, electronic warfare capabilities, missile defense technologies, and mission-critical sensors used by the U.S. military, intelligence community, and allied nations around the world.
